
springboot
文章平均质量分 89
1加一
这个作者很懒,什么都没留下…
展开
-
注解@ConfigurationProperties使用方法
前言以前传统的Spring一般都是基本xml配置的,后来spring3.0新增了许多java config的注解,特别是spring boot,基本都是清一色的java config。Spring配置方式第一阶段:xml配置在spring 1.x时代,使用spring开发满眼都是xml配置的bean,随着项目的扩大,我们需要把xml配置文件分放到不同的配置文件中,那时候需要频繁地在开发的类和配置文件间切换。第二阶段:注解配置在spring 2.x时代,随着JDK1.5带来的注解支持,spring转载 2021-10-12 21:24:42 · 808 阅读 · 0 评论 -
springboot启动时执行任务CommandLineRunner
# SpringBoot中CommandLineRunner的作用> 平常开发中有可能需要实现在项目启动后执行的功能,SpringBoot提供的一种简单的实现方案就是添加一个model并实现CommandLineRunner接口,实现功能的代码放在实现的run方法中# 简单例子``` javapackage org.springboot.sample.runner;import o...转载 2020-04-13 21:38:23 · 127 阅读 · 0 评论 -
springboot跨域配置
跨域并非浏览器限制了发起跨站请求,而是跨站请求可以正常发起,但是返回结果被浏览器拦截了。最好的例子是CSRF跨站攻击原理,请求是发送到了后端服务器无论是否跨域!注意:有些浏览器不允许从HTTPS的域跨域访问HTTP,比如Chrome和Firefox,这些浏览器在请求还未发出的时候就会拦截请求,这是一个特例。引自:https://developer.mozilla.org/zh-CN/docs/...转载 2019-05-30 16:36:50 · 271 阅读 · 1 评论 -
springboot :集成httpclient连接池技术
package com.xf.station.config;import org.apache.http.client.config.RequestConfig;import org.apache.http.client.methods.CloseableHttpResponse;import org.apache.http.client.methods.HttpGet;impor...转载 2019-05-30 17:07:40 · 2322 阅读 · 0 评论 -
SpringBoot:Profile多环境支持
Profifile介绍Profile是Spring用来针对不同环境要求,提供不同的配置支持,全局Profile配置使用的文件名称可以是,application-{profile}.properties / application-{profile}.yml;例如application-dev.properties/application-prod.yml因为我觉得yml文件看的比较清楚所,下...原创 2019-06-06 10:26:15 · 169 阅读 · 0 评论 -
SpringBoot:@ConfigurationProperties@PropertySource@ImportResource
Spring Boot的配置文件1.Spring Boot使用一个全局配置文件,放置在src/main/resources目录或类路径/config下:application.properties application.yml2.配置文件的作用:修改Spring Boot自动配置的默认值3.yml时YAML(YAML Ain't Markup Language)不是一个标记语言...原创 2019-06-06 14:47:31 · 247 阅读 · 0 评论 -
Spring Cloud & Spring Boot 依赖关系
Cloud代号(英国伦敦地铁站名) Boot版本 Greenwich 2.1.x Finchley 2.0.x Edgware 1.5.x Dalston 1.5.x GA : General Availability,正式发布的版本,官方推荐使用此版本。在国外都是用GA来说明release版本的;PRE : 预览版,内部测试版. 主要是给开发人...原创 2019-06-15 10:45:58 · 291 阅读 · 0 评论